Automobile manufacturers have certainly started acknowledging the fact that post-COVID phase will not be anything similar to our normal lives, we will have to learn to live with COVID, which means many changes are bound to happen.

Prominent manufacturers, in turn, are working out on plausible measures to continue their operations even with the substantial impact, COVID is expected to have on our lives.

With top automotive companies like Maruti Suzuki, Hyundai and VW making announcements regarding road plan for resumption, even Mahindra is all set to launch 'Own-Online ', which they claim as the most complete online ownership solution.Â

Mahindra SUV on SYouV portal

Own-Online will provide the customer with an online interface that will help the buyers with important automobile-related concerns like finance, exchange and accessories.

Mahindra defines four easy steps for easy ownership as:-

  1. Explore and personalize
  2. Get instant Exchange quotations
  3. Choose finance and insurance
  4. Payment and doorstep delivery      

Official Word

Vijay Nakra, CEO- Automotive division, Mahindra & Mahindra Ltd. said after the launch of Own-Online 'Today we are delighted to launch 'Own-Online' platform, India's most complete end-to-end, online car ownership solution. Its easy & convenient 4-step journey allows the customer to own a Mahindra vehicle in less time than it takes to get a pizza delivered!

'With our pre and post-purchase online solutions already in place, reimagining the car purchase experience was a logical next step for us. In recent times, online has been a preferred purchase channel across categories and going forward, the online purchase of vehicles is set to gain more traction. We are ready to lead this change in automotive retail by providing many industry-first experiences to our customers'

What exactly is Own-Online?

It is a one-stop interface that will assist all of Mahindra's customers with pre-ownership and purchase phase of the vehicle, it will offer the customers with the convenience of a contactless process that will take care of everything right from vehicle selection to delivery.

Mahindra has made sure that they cover all those customers who will be exchanging their old cars, the online platform will provide the customers with a real-time quotation that will facilitate an easy and transparent exchange procedure.

The own-online interface further consists of platforms like SYouV, it is supposed to assist the customers with a convenient procedure of selecting a vehicle and platform named With You Hamesha will help the customers with the options of availing post buying facilities like online booking of service, viewing online history and receiving service invoices.
